NYSDOT commended for 511NY traffic information service

ALBANY – The New York State Department of Transportation (NYSDOT) has won two Best of New York awards from the Center for Digital Government – the Most Innovative Use of Social Media award and the Demonstrated Excellence in Project Management award – for the Department’s 511NY traffic conditions notification system.

The annual Best of New York awards recognizes New York’s top technology leaders and teams from state agencies and local governments for contributions, best practices and works of distinction in information technology.

The Department and Todd Westhuis, Acting Director of NYSDOT’s Office of Traffic Safety and Mobility, were recognized at a ceremony hosted by the Center for Digital Government this week in Albany.

511NY is New York’s one-stop travel information service that informs drivers about traffic conditions across the state.
